
Mortgage Account Executive - REMOTE (Sacramento, CA) New Sacramento, CA
Knock GO, Sacramento, California, United States, 95828
Knock is redefining the home buying and selling experience. A passionate team of experts is building a simpler way for people to navigate the home journey. That people‑first mindset is core to how we operate, and why Knock has been honored as one of Inc.’s Best Workplaces six times in the past seven years.
Founded in 2015, Knock has grown into a trusted partner for thousands of homebuyers and a network of over 60,000 loan officers and agents nationwide. Backed by top investors, we’ve earned 900+ five‑star Zillow and Trustpilot reviews and an A+ BBB rating.
We’re looking for a sales‑driven, partner‑obsessed Account Executive to join our high‑performing sales team and help shape the future of homebuying. This hunting role requires strong outbound sales capability and lending experience to generate new business for Knock’s first‑of‑its‑kind Knock Bridge Loan™.
What You’ll Do
Execute outbound cold outreach to generate interest and convert prospects into active lending partners that drive loan applications
Host regular meetings and training sessions with loan officers, team leads, branch managers, brokers, and agents to share updates, review performance, and optimize use of Knock’s offerings
Consistently meet or exceed monthly goals for driving new business within an assigned territory
Partner with lenders and brokers to drive new loan applications for Knock
Lead operational and strategic initiatives that grow top‑of‑funnel activity and drive both new and repeat applications
Achieve monthly loan application sales targets, with a minimum expectation of 70 applications per month
Collaborate cross‑functionally with internal teams to deliver a seamless experience for our partners and their customers
Track, analyze, and report on key performance metrics including outreach activity, partnerships, leads, and loan applications
Champion collaboration and foster a positive, team‑oriented work environment
What You’ll Bring
Recent lending experience or an active NMLS license (required)
Recent experience working directly with lenders
Experience in SaaS sales is a strong plus
Ability to execute cold outbound outreach and build a healthy sales pipeline
Proven, measurable success in meeting or exceeding sales targets
Creative and strategic thinker with a passion for growing partnerships and improving partner experiences
Excellent commun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ills with the ability to confidently engage senior stakeholders
Performance‑driven mindset with a focus on partner success
Team‑oriented attitude with a passion for supporting and uplifting others
Receptive to coaching and open to giving/receiving constructive feedback
Ability to thrive in a fast‑paced, ever‑changing environment while managing multiple priorities
Strong relationship‑building skills rooted in trust and transparency
A deep belief in fostering inclusive, equitable practices that reflect Knock’s core values
Proven success in a fully remote, distributed team environment
Minimum of 2 years of business development or growth experience
High school diploma or equivalent (required)
Compensation and Benefits Base salary range: $55,000 - $60,000 USD. Uncapped incentive plan available. On‑target earnings (OTE) estimate: $189,000 USD.
Benefits include:
100% remote work culture
Top tier medical, dental, & vision benefits for full‑time employees starting on day one
Flexible Paid Time Off for full‑time employees
Paid parental leave: 12 weeks for birthing parent, 6 weeks for non‑birthing parent
Annual professional development stipend: $1,000
Life, AD&D, and disability insurance for full‑time employees
401(k) (noncontributory by Knock) for all employees
$75 monthly allowance for health & wellness
Up to $400 monthly co‑working space allowance for eligible employees
$100 monthly allowance for home internet, mobile phone, or other communication devices
$2,500 referral bonus for eligible employees
